Major Research Areas

  • Invertebrate faunistics, standardized methods for inventories and RBA (Rapid Biodiversity Assessment), biodiversity evaluation.
  • The search for the best biodiversity indicators
  • Island biogeography, mosaic concept, habitat fragmentation
  • Evaluation of the effects of ecological compensation areas and ecotone structures in agriculture and forestry (on pest insects, beneficials, biodiversity)
  • Conservation biology, Red Data Book, enhancement of threatened animal species in Switzerland
